Odisha Channel Bureau Bhubaneswar: The winter session of the Odisha Assembly was adjourned sine die today.Odisha-AssemblySpeaker Niranjan Pujari adjourned the House sine die 10 days before the scheduled date after a motion in this regard was moved by Government Chief Whip Ananta Das.The opposition MLAs were absent in the House when the Assembly was adjourned sine die.The MLAs of opposition Congress and BJP had abstained from the House for the second day demanding that the Speaker should reconsider his decision about suspension of senior Congress MLA Naba Kishore Das from the House for seven days.Das was suspended without being given an opportunity to clarify his stand relating to the allegation that he watched an objectionable video in the House on Monday.The ruling BJD was keen to end the session early to engage the legislators in preparations for the statewide celebration of the party’s foundation day on December 26.
